Strategy and Operations Lead, Ads, Go-To-Market

Google is seeking a Strategy and Operations Lead for its Ads Go-To-Market team. The role involves leading cross-functional projects, optimizing product performance, and ensuring effective execution of the go-to-market strategy for Google’s Ads products.

Responsibilities

Work cross-functionally with cross-GTM teams, People Operations, Business Finance, Marketing, and communications to scope, manage, and execute projects
Derive insights from quantitative and qualitative data analysis; communicate key findings to executive leadership with executive-ready presentations and program manage efforts on behalf of stakeholders
Drive operating for the organization, including optimizing resource allocation, measuring progress against key objectives, and managing business updates or quarterly reviews
Analyze business processes to identify potential issues and uncover levers for improvement; influence executive stakeholders to implement standardization and optimization strategies

Required

Bachelor's degree or equivalent practical experience
6 years of experience in management consulting, sales operations, business strategy, investment banking, venture capital, private equity, or corporate advisory, or 4 years of experience with an advanced degree

Preferred

Experience managing relationships and working cross-functionally within global organizations
Understanding of Global Business Organization (GBO) and its business channels and teams (i.e., LCS, GCS, rGTM, GST, etc.)
Ability to understand and articulate the big picture to executive teams, while maintaining attention to execution details
Excellent communication skills to help teams move with greater speed and efficiency to big outcomes
Excellent program management skills with the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ously that span Alphabet's different divisions
